In the biggest game of the season thus far, the hometown kid came through. Junior Rob Hanna scored a career high 24 points, shooting 10-12 from the field. The Linn-Mar prep nailed four of five three point shots as well.
Senior Mike Kilburg played a season-high 35 minutes and put everyone one of them to use as he came away with 20 points and six rebounds. He also had a team high three steals and a block.
After trailing 16-6 five minutes into the game, the Kohawks settled down and went on a 29-12 run over the next 12 minutes. Trailing by two at halftime, Coe opened the second half with 17-10 run.
After Coe took a 79-75 lead with 1:15 to play, the Knights scored four unanswered to send the game to overtime, including a three point basket by Lee Nelson from five feet beyond the line.
Coe opened a 90-83 lead in overtime, but gave up an 8-2 run by Wartburg to end the game.
The Kohawks will have the week off before heading to Des Moines for a non-conference game with Grand View. The game will tip-off at 7:30 p.m.
